The Certificate Programme in Behavior Modification for Children with Learning Disabilities equips educators, parents, and professionals with actionable strategies to support children facing learning challenges. This course delves into evidence-based techniques, including positive reinforcement, cognitive-behavioral approaches, and individualized intervention plans. Participants will gain insights into managing behavioral issues, fostering emotional resilience, and enhancing academic performance in children with learning disabilities. Designed for the digital age, the programme integrates practical tools and resources to empower learners in creating inclusive, supportive environments. | career roles | key responsibilities |
|---|---|
| behavioral therapist | design and implement behavior modification plans monitor progress and adjust strategies |
| special education teacher | create individualized education plans (IEPs) collaborate with parents and professionals |
| child psychologist | assess learning disabilities provide counseling and support |
| educational consultant | advise schools on inclusive practices train teachers in behavior modification techniques |
| parent coach | guide parents in managing challenging behaviors provide resources and strategies |
| speech-language pathologist | address communication challenges integrate behavior modification into therapy |
| occupational therapist | develop sensory integration plans support daily living skills development |
